Product Definition:
Aerospace threaded fasteners are used to connect two or more pieces of metal together. They are often made from high-quality materials, such as stainless steel, to ensure a strong connection. The importance of aerospace threaded fasteners is that they provide a secure connection between parts and help keep aircrafts safe and stable in flight.

Growth Factors:
- Increasing demand for air travel: The global air travel industry is growing at a rapid pace, owing to the increasing number of passengers travelling for both business and leisure purposes. This is expected to drive the demand for aerospace threaded fasteners in the coming years.
- Growing investments in the aerospace sector: Governments and private investors are making significant investments in the aerospace sector, which is expected to boost the demand for aerospace threaded fasteners in the near future.
- Technological advancements: The aviation industry is witnessing rapid technological advancements, which is resulting in new aircraft designs and improved performance of aircraft components. This is likely to create opportunities for growth of the Aerospace Threaded Fasteners market over the next few years.
